Forlagsbeskrivelse af I Want to Love You Till Your Dying Day 6 af Nachi Aono

There's an orphanage for girls that's actually a boot camp, turning out magical child soldiers for a gruesome war. Yet love finds a way to blossom amid bloodshed, in this dramatic, much-anticipated yuri manga that is spiritrual kin to the likes of Revolutionary Girl Utena, Otherside Picnic, and Mobile Suit Gundam: The Witch From Mercury.  Finding Hope After the Grief Ari is still grieving after losing Seiran, but a heart-to-heart with her upperclassman Esther helps her feel better. Meanwhile, school life goes on for the students of the facility, from health check-ups to late-night snacks - and speculations about the origins of the war they’re fighting in the first place. As the roommates continue to spend their days together, Sheena begins to realize her feelings for Mimi just might go beyond the bounds of friendly cohabitation...  Love blossoms amid bloodshed in a new, enthralling dystopian yuri manga There's an orphanage for girls that's actually a boot camp, turning out magical child soldiers for a gruesome war.
